New & Used Cars for Sale under $20,000 & under 60000 Miles in Birmingham, AL

Filters

Filter Advanced Filters
Sort By
Great Deal

Used 2014 Kia Sorento EX

$19,590
45,511 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671
Great Deal

Used 2017 Chevrolet Equinox LT

$18,998
59,374 mi.
mi. from 35259
1675 Montgomery Hwy S Birmingham, AL 35216
(205) 847-2639
Great Deal

Used 2013 Toyota Camry SE

$18,590
55,068 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671
Great Deal

Used 2019 Kia Soul Base

$17,385
51,511 mi.
mi. from 35259
5009 Brooke's Crossing Blvd Birmingham, AL 35235
(205) 578-3378
Great Deal

Used 2018 Kia Forte LX

$16,990
40,123 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671
Great Deal

Used 2017 Kia Forte LX

$16,298
27,168 mi.
mi. from 35259
1001 Tom Williams Way Irondale, AL 35210
(888) 769-4077
Great Deal

Used 2015 Chevrolet Malibu 2LT

$17,590
39,681 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671
Great Deal

Used 2015 Nissan Altima 2.5

$17,590
49,138 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671
Great Deal

Used 2013 FIAT 500 Sport Turbo

$15,990
9,692 mi.
Online vendor
ONLINE ONLY - No Retail Location Birmingham, AL 35203
(205) 409-4671

Cars by Body Style

Cars by Price

Cars for Sale by Make